Kats put scare into No. 2 LSU

FRISCO – Sam Houston gave No. 2 LSU all it could handle on Sunday, but could not overcome a 7-run second inning by the Tigers in a 12-8 loss at Riders Field on the final day of the Frisco College Classic. 

The Tigers (11-1) finished off a perfect weekend in Frisco and did so with one big inning and a litany of answers for the Bearkats (2-9) who scored in four straight innings in its best offensive showing of the tournament.  

Every Bearkat hitter reached base in the game and Hunter Autrey and Parker Blackman each drove in a pair of runs as Sam Houston took advantage of drawing 10 free passes from Tiger pitchers while adding nine hits of their own. 

But they played from behind from the early going after Steven Milam opened the second inning with a solo home run. LSU went on to add six more runs in the inning, including five with two outs in the frame against starter Connor Zaruba who took his first loss of the season.  

The Kats answered with two runs in the third and went on to score single runs in both the fourth and fifth innings, but LSU answered and still held an 11-4 lead entering the sixth when the Kats immediately loaded the bases with nobody out. Jace Martinez delivered an RBI single and Sam Houston added three more on a walk, ground ball and sac fly, but could not find the game-changing hit it was searching for.  

LSU starter Chase Shores earned the win with 5.0 innings of work, punching out five and allowing four runs before giving way to the bullpen. The Kats used four arms of their own with relief appearances from Danny Valadez, Felix Schlede and Garrett Baumann.  

Following the conclusion of the tournament, freshman outfielder Parker Blackman was named to the Frisco Classic All-Tournament team. 

UP NEXT 
The Kats will continue their 9-game road stretch next week, beginning Wednesday night at UT Arlington. That single game will be followed by a 3-game series at No. 16 Oklahoma beginning Friday at L. Dale Mitchell Park.
